Output 96a21b2463ec3a9f6d0ebd826fc8e767708a72639b67ae09e303473fd3883c3d:69

value
199996193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8863bc916e63a80ee8b1181b1d648e1df19891 OP_EQUAL
address
3MhoJ51M6QV9ZBcezSQJf6irYzjqZpdjyt
transaction
96a21b2463ec3a9f6d0ebd826fc8e767708a72639b67ae09e303473fd3883c3d
spent
true